    Did you know the "King of Rock & Roll" didn’t actually invent the sound? Long before Elvis Presley or Chuck Berry took the stage, a Black woman with a Gibson SG was shredding solos that would change music history forever. In this deep-dive documentary, we reclaim the legacy of Sister Rosetta Tharpe, the true Godmother of Rock and Roll. From the cotton fields of Arkansas to filling a stadium with 25,000 people for her wedding, Rosetta’s life was a masterclass in Black excellence, business savvy, and musical revolution. We explore her untold history, her "mansion on wheels" that bypassed Jim Crow laws, and the secret influence she had on icons like Little Richard and Johnny Cash.
